Here is a list of some events happened on February 18.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
1861 | In Montgomery, Alabama, Jefferson Davis is inaugurated as the provisional President of the Confederate States of America. |
2014 | At least 76 people are killed and hundreds are injured in clashes between riot police and demonstrators in Kyiv, Ukraine. |
1970 | The Chicago Seven are found not guilty of conspiring to incite riots at the 1968 Democratic National Convention. |
2021 | Perseverance, a Mars rover designed to explore Jezero crater on Mars, as part of NASA's Mars 2020 mission, lands successfully. |
1911 | The first official flight with airmail takes place from Allahabad, United Provinces, British India (now India), when Henri Pequet, a 23-year-old pilot, delivers 6,500 letters to Naini, about 10 kilometres (6.2 mi) away. |
1637 | Eighty Years' War: Off the coast of Cornwall, England, a Spanish fleet intercepts an important Anglo-Dutch merchant convoy of 44 vessels escorted by six warships, destroying or capturing 20 of them. |
1954 | The first Church of Scientology is established in Los Angeles. |
1930 | While studying photographs taken in January, Clyde Tombaugh discovers Pluto. |
1900 | Second Boer War: Imperial forces suffer their worst single-day loss of life on Bloody Sunday, the first day of the Battle of Paardeberg. |
1268 | The Battle of Wesenberg is fought between the Livonian Order and Dovmont of Pskov. |
